Is $75K a good salary in Long Beach?

At $75K/year in Long Beach, your estimated monthly take-home is $4,159. With 1BR rent around $2,400/month, rent takes up 58% of your take-home. That's considered difficult.

Is $75K a good salary in Columbia?

At $75K/year in Columbia, your estimated monthly take-home is $4,353. With 1BR rent around $1,250/month, rent takes up 29% of your take-home. That's considered manageable.

Which city is more affordable on a $75K salary?

Columbia leaves you with more money after core expenses โ€” $2,485/month vs $1,033/month in Long Beach.

Can I afford to live alone in Long Beach on $75K?

It's tight. Rent in Long Beach would take 58% of your $75K take-home pay. You may need to find roommates or look at studios to stay within the 30% rule.
